Comnet FVT1031M1 Digitally Encoded Video Transmitter / Data Transceiver

Overview

The FVT1031M1 is a single-fiber video transmitter designed to extend analog camera feeds over extended distances where running copper coax becomes impractical or cost-prohibitive. It encodes composite video and simultaneous RS422 data onto a single 1310/1550 nm optical fiber via ST connector, reaching 3 km with a 16 dB loss budget. This unit solves the distance and conduit-congestion problem in stadium, campus, industrial facility, and transportation hub deployments where camera-to-NVR runs exceed standard coax limits.

Compatibility

The FVT1031M1 works with any system capable of sourcing standard composite video (NTSC/PAL) and RS422 PTZ or control serial data. Typical pairs: Comnet fiber video receiver units (FVR-series matching single-fiber or dual-fiber configurations), legacy analog camera plants feeding fiber-extended backbone networks, and hybrid surveillance systems bridging older analog infrastructure with modern IP core. Confirm the receiver model supports 1310/1550 nm wavelength matching and ST connector type before deployment.

Installation Notes

Input voltage 8–15 VDC at 2W consumption — typically sourced from a local UPS or power distribution module at the transmitter cabinet. Video signal acceptance: composite signals within standard bandwidth (5 Hz–6.5 MHz). RS422 data rate up to 250 kbps NRZ. Operating temperature range −40°C to +75°C supports outdoor equipment cabinets and unheated utility enclosures; verify receiving equipment is rated for the same range if co-located. Fiber runs beyond 3 km require optical repeaters or higher-grade loss-budget components. ST connector cleanliness is critical — use dust caps when not mated. MTBF >100,000 hours assumes proper power conditioning and thermal management within spec.

Specifications
Video Bandwidth: 5 Hz – 6.5 MHz
Video Signal To Noise Ratio: 67 dB

Power Input Voltage: 8 to 15 VDC
Power Consumption: 2W
Data Interface: RS422, UTC
Data Rate: DC-250 Kbps (NRZ)
Optical Wavelength: 1310/1550 nm
Optical Number Of Fibers: 1
Optical Emitter: Laser Diode
Optical Connector: ST
Optical Loss Budget: 16dB
Optical Max Distance: 3 km (2 mi)
Mechanical Size: 4.0 x 2.5 in (10.16 x 6.4 cm)

Environmental Operating Temp: -40° C to +75° C
Environmental Storage Temp: -40° C to +85° C
Environmental Relative Humidity: 0% to 95% (non-condensing)
Environmental MTBF: >100,000 hours
Compliance: FDA Performance Standard for Laser Products
